Garage door pricing isn't one-size-fits-all. In Clackamas, you're looking at anywhere from $600 for a basic repair to $4,000+ for a premium installation with a smart opener. A simple spring replacement runs $300,$600. A mid-range steel door with standard installation? Plan on $1,500,$2,500. A custom wood door with insulation and a belt-drive opener? You could hit $3,500,$4,500.
The wide range exists because every garage is different. Your door width, height, material choice, insulation needs, and whether you need a new opener all affect the final bill. That's why getting a quote.not a guess.matters.
Material choice is the biggest lever. Steel doors are durable and affordable ($1,200,$2,200 installed). Aluminum and glass blend aesthetics with moderate pricing ($1,800,$3,000). Wood doors are beautiful but expensive and require maintenance ($2,500,$4,500+). Spring type affects cost and lifespan. Torsion springs (standard, safer, last 7,9 years) run $200,$400 per pair. Extension springs (older, cheaper, less safe) cost $100,$200 but are riskier. If you're replacing springs, always replace both at the same time.a fact I've seen ignored too many times, leading to second failures weeks later.
Opener upgrades add $300,$800. Chain drives are affordable but noisy. Belt drives cost more but run quietly. Smart openers with app control and safety sensors push the price up but give you remote access and better protection.especially important if you have kids or pets around the door.
Labor and same-day availability matter in Clackamas. Emergency service or same-day installation costs more than scheduled work. Standard installation during business hours? Budget 2,4 hours labor. Weekend or evening? Expect a service fee on top.

Never trust a phone quote alone. A legitimate estimate requires a technician to see your door in person. They'll measure, inspect springs, check the opener, and identify hidden issues.like a bent track or worn hinges that need fixing.
When you call for an estimate, mention: - Your door's current condition (working, stuck, noisy, broken?) - Whether you want a replacement or repair, Your budget range, Any specific features you want (insulation, color, opener type)
This speeds up the estimate process and ensures you get accurate pricing. At Garage Door Clackamas, we provide detailed written estimates before any work starts.no surprises.
If you're comparing quotes from different companies, watch for red flags: estimates that seem too cheap (corners cut), vague pricing, or pressure to decide immediately. A reputable company will answer questions and stand behind their quote.
Sometimes a repair is smarter than replacement. A broken spring? Fix it ($300,$600). A bent panel? Repair it ($200,$400). A non-functioning opener? Replace it ($400,$800). But if your door is 15+ years old, heavily damaged, or has multiple failing parts, replacement often makes sense long-term.

Beyond the door and opener, consider: - Permits (Clackamas requires them; usually $50,$150) - Removal of old door (often included, but confirm) - Weatherstripping and seals (add $100,$200 for better insulation) - Safety sensors (essential; $150,$300)
Missing these in your budget estimate leads to sticker shock. Ask any contractor for a *full* estimate that includes everything.

Q: How long does a garage door typically last? A: Steel doors last 15,20 years with proper maintenance. Wood doors may last 10,15 years due to weather exposure. Springs need replacement every 7,9 years regardless of door age.

Q: Is a smart opener worth the extra cost? A: If you value remote access, safety alerts, and smartphone control, yes. Smart openers cost $200,$400 more but offer peace of mind and convenience, especially for families with children.
Q: Should I replace my door if it still works? A: If it's 15+ years old, noisy, drafty, or requires frequent repairs, replacement is often more cost-effective long-term than repeated fixes.
Q: What warranty should I expect? A: Quality doors come with 10,15 year warranties on the door itself. Openers typically have 5,10 year warranties. Always ask for written warranty details before purchase.
